BYU Football Profile: Brayden El-Bakri (Class of 2012)

El_Bakri_brayden_por1Brayden El-Bakri is a 6’0” 215 pound running back for the BYU football team (Class of 2012). He redshirted prior to an LDS mission (Uruguay, Montevideo West) and is hoping to get some reps as a freshman walk-on for the 2015 season.

El-Bakri prepped at Brighton High School, where as a junior he had 204 yards rushing, one touchdown reception, 80 total tackles, and one interception. He was named to the Deseret News 5A all-state second team as a defensive back.   As a senior he ran for 566 yards and 7 touchdowns, had 10 receptions for 118 yards, and recorded 79 total tackles. He was named to the Deseret News 5A all-state second team as a linebacker. He also played baseball and lacrosse for Brighton.

El-Bakri was not rated by Rivals, Scout, or ESPN. He originally walked-on (2012) as a linebacker but he could play running back as well.
